安卓端Java实现QQ邮件发送技术要点分析

需积分: 10 0 下载量 96 浏览量 更新于2024-10-31 收藏 105KB ZIP 举报
资源摘要信息:"安卓java发送qq邮件完整源码" 知识点详细说明: 1. 安卓java编程:安卓开发是基于Java语言的一种移动应用开发方式,掌握java语言是进行安卓应用开发的基础。安卓java发送邮件涉及到安卓平台上邮件发送功能的实现,这通常会使用到JavaMail API,该API是Java EE的一部分,专门用于处理邮件传输。 2. JavaScript中的apply方法:在JavaScript中,apply方法用于调用一个具有给定this值的函数,以及作为一个数组提供的参数。apply方法的作用和call方法类似,区别在于apply接受的是一个参数数组,而不是参数列表。apply经常被用于构造函数继承的场景,或者是调用某个对象的某个方法,同时改变这个方法内部的this指向。 3. JavaScript基础:包括对JavaScript高级程序设计、数据结构与算法的深入学习,这是进行前端开发或全栈开发的必备基础。理解JavaScript中的算法与数据结构对于编写高效且可维护的代码至关重要。 4. 计算机核心课程知识:计算机科学专业的学生需要系统地学习多门核心课程,其中包括数学课(线性代数、概率统计、离散数学、高等数学/数学分析),这些都是计算机科学的理论基础。此外,数据结构与算法、计算机体系结构、操作系统、计算机网络等课程也是必不可少的,它们帮助学生构建计算机系统和网络的全面理解。 5. 经典教材推荐:对于计算机科学的学习者来说,选择合适的教材非常重要。在上述描述中提到了一些被广泛认可的经典教材,如《算法导论》、《计算机组成与设计》以及《现代操作系统》等。这些书籍为学习者提供了扎实的理论基础。 6. 资源开源与共享:标题中提到的“系统开源”表明,这些资料可能来源于开源社区,开源意味着软件的源代码可以被公开获取和修改。开源文化鼓励了全球开发者之间的协作和共享,这有助于知识的传播和技术的进步。 7. 文件结构说明:文件名"js_querstion_note-master"暗示了这是一套JavaScript问题记录的源码文件,文件名中的"master"可能表示这是一个主分支或主版本的代码,通常用来指代GitHub等版本控制系统中的主项目仓库。 综上所述,这段文件信息覆盖了移动应用开发、JavaScript编程、计算机科学核心课程、教材推荐以及开源文化等多个方面的知识点。对于希望深化技术理解或开始计算机科学学习的个人来说,这些信息提供了宝贵的学习资源和实践指南。